With 120 pumps and more than 350 employees, this gas station is no ordinary pit stop. Crowds of people gathered in Sevierville, Tennessee, starting at midnight to be part of the supersized grand opening of the world's largest gas station on June 26. At a gargantuan 74,000 square feet, the newest location for the gas station chain Buc-ee's has everything from fresh fudge to barbecue sandwiches to even bathing suits. It also is open 24 hours a day, seven days a week. There's a statue of the Buc-ee's mascot at the store in addition to one that can be seen from the highway.TODAYNBC News correspondent Kathy Park was at the location just outside the Great Smoky Mountains to witness the spectacle when the new Buc-ee's officially opened for business. It's not hard to find, as a larger-than-life beaver mascot for the popular chain can be seen for miles on the interstate. Buc-ee's originated in Texas in 1982 and has expanded across the South to become a travel destination unto itself. The new store includes their signature brisket sandwiches and other barbecue items made fresh right at the location. NBC News correspondent Kathy Park was "an honorary pitmaster" for the day, pitching in to make Buc-ee's signature barbecue sandwiches.TODAY"We slow-smoke it, we season it, and we get it out to the store and slice it up fresh right in front," Randy Pauly, the director of barbecue operations at the new Buc-ee's, said on TODAY. Rainbow BridgeThe Rainbow Bridge in Baxter Springs, Kansas, is a historic gem on Route 66. Built in 1923, this single-span concrete Marsh arch bridge—nicknamed for its graceful rainbow-like design—served travelers until 1960 and was restored in 1994. Listed on the National Register of Historic Places, it’s one of the few remaining bridges of its kind.22. Dairy KingDairy King in Commerce, Oklahoma, is a vintage gas station turned Route 66 eatery, serving up nostalgia alongside burgers, milkshakes, and its famous Route 66 cookies. Originally a 1927 Marathon station, this cottage-style gem evolved into a Tydol station before becoming the Dairy King under Treva and Kenneth Duboise in 1980. Still family-run today, it’s a must-visit spot to grab a bite and soak in the charm of yesteryear on your Route 66 journey.23. Ed Galloway’s Totem Pole ParkEd Galloway’s Totem Pole Park in Foyil, Oklahoma, is a Route 66 stop featuring the “World’s Largest Concrete Totem Pole,” a stunning 90-foot folk art masterpiece crafted by Nathan Edward Galloway. Built from 28 tons of concrete, scrap metal, and red sandstone, the totem pole is adorned with intricate carvings of turtles, lizards, owls, and Native American chiefs, topped by nine-foot tribal figures. Supertam On 66 Ice Cream Parlor And Superman MuseumSuperTAM on 66 Ice Cream Parlor and Superman Museum in Carterville, Missouri, is a sweet stop blending superhero nostalgia with Route 66 charm. Originally called “Superman on Rt 66,” the parlor boasts a massive collection of Superman memorabilia, from action figures to vintage stamps, alongside Route 66 photos and signs. Renamed after copyright issues, it still serves up treats like the “Kryptonite Delight” and Superman ice cream. Now under new ownership, SuperTAM continues to be a fun, family-friendly destination for a scoop and some superhero history on the Mother Road.18. Red Oak IIRed Oak II in Carthage, Missouri, is a unique blend of open-air museum, historical landmark, and art project just off Route 66. Spanning nearly 60 acres, this recreated early 20th-century town features structures moved from the original Red Oak, Missouri, including a Phillips 66 station, schoolhouse, general store, and blacksmith shop.
